Description

FIG. 1 shows a front perspective view of an automotive gage with a scalloped bezel, three-dimensional needle, and push-buttons according to an alternate embodiment of the inventive design having an enlarged face.

FIG. 2 shows a rear perspective view of the automotive gage of FIG. 1 with connector flats omitted on the rear of the gage.

FIG. 3 shows a front view of the automotive gage of FIG. 1.

FIG. 4 shows a rear view of the automotive gage of FIG. 1.

FIG. 5 shows a right side view of the automotive gage of FIG. 1.

FIG. 6 shows a left side view of the automotive gage of FIG. 1.

FIG. 7 shows a front perspective view an automotive gage with a scalloped bezel and three-dimensional needle according to another alternate embodiment of the inventive design having no push-buttons; and,

FIG. 8 shows a rear perspective view of the automotive gage of FIG. 7.

The broken line showing is for illustrative purposes only and forms no part of the claimed design.
